    Description

    Position: ServiceNow Architect
    Location: Chicago, IL
    Duration: 6-12 Months


    Essential Job Functions
    Join in the development and implementation of the Enterprise Application Architecture function. This role, working alongside other application architects, will work with senior leaders to develop and architect strategic initiatives that align with the organization's overall objectives with a keen focus in our service management platform - ServiceNow. To be successful in this role, the Enterprise Application Architect Principle should have strong ServiceNow experience, leadership and communication skills, attention to detail, as well as a deep understanding of relevant technology trends, App Engine design patterns and best practices. Additionally, this role should be able to think strategically and work collaboratively with other departments to achieve the organization's goals.
    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S (This list is not exhaustive and may be supplemented and changed as necessary.)
    • Partake in the development of ServiceNow application architecture, including the Target State Application Architecture that addresses the Statement of Architecture Work and stakeholder expectations.
    • Ensuring that ServiceNow architectures are aligned with the organization's overall solution goals and objectives.
    • Develop and maintain reference architecture, architecture building blocks (ABB), standards, and guidelines to ensure that the organization's technology is secure and compliant with industry standards.
    • Identify areas for capability improvement and implementing strategies and roadmaps to address them.
    • Collaborate with stakeholders across the organization to identify and participate in prioritization initiatives.
    • Stay up to date with emerging technology trends and developments and evaluating their potential impact on the organization.
    • Communicating technology target state, roadmap, and development progress to senior leadership and other stakeholders.
    Qualifications & Requirements
    Education, Work Experience, Skills
    Required:
    • Bachelor's degree in computer science, information systems, data science, or related field.
    • 8+ years of experience with ServiceNow (ITSM, ITOM, ITBM, CMDB, APM, SPM, App Engine), preferred in a global capacity.
    • Strong knowledge of architecture governance concepts, application design patterns, and best practices.
    • Experience developing and implementing architecture governance, guidelines, procedures, and standards.
    • Experience with one or more platforms such as Salesforce.com (Sales, Marketing Cloud), MuleSoft, Azure, Microsoft M365.
    • Proven change management skills.
    • Excellent communication, diplomacy, and interpersonal skills.
    •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ills.
    • Ability to work effectively with business and IT cross-functional teams.
    • Experience leading a team of architects, technology owners, and technology subject matter experts.
    Preferred:
    • Strong presentation skills
    • Business Process Model and Notation (BPMN) experiences
    • Work experience at a large professional services organization
    Certificates, Licensures, Registrations
    • Preferred: TOGAF certification
    • Preferred: ServiceNow Technical or Master Architect certification
    Tools and Equipment
    • Microsoft office automation tools (Word, Excel, PowerPoint, SharePoint), Visio
